This was detected by Coverity.

Cc: Himanshu Madhani <hmadh...@marvell.com>
Cc: Giridhar Malavali <gmalav...@marvell.com>
Signed-off-by: Bart Van Assche <bvanass...@acm.org>
---
 drivers/scsi/qla2xxx/qla_os.c | 17 -----------------
 1 file changed, 17 deletions(-)

diff --git a/drivers/scsi/qla2xxx/qla_os.c b/drivers/scsi/qla2xxx/qla_os.c
index 13ff52339df8..5faf2d5d5060 100644
--- a/drivers/scsi/qla2xxx/qla_os.c
+++ b/drivers/scsi/qla2xxx/qla_os.c
@@ -5712,7 +5712,6 @@ qla83xx_idc_lock_recovery(scsi_qla_host_t *base_vha)
 void
 qla83xx_idc_lock(scsi_qla_host_t *base_vha, uint16_t requester_id)
 {
-       uint16_t options = (requester_id << 15) | BIT_6;
        uint32_t data;
        uint32_t lock_owner;
        struct qla_hw_data *ha = base_vha->hw;
@@ -5745,22 +5744,6 @@ qla83xx_idc_lock(scsi_qla_host_t *base_vha, uint16_t 
requester_id)
        }
 
        return;
-
-       /* XXX: IDC-lock implementation using access-control mbx */
-retry_lock2:
-       if (qla83xx_access_control(base_vha, options, 0, 0, NULL)) {
-               ql_dbg(ql_dbg_p3p, base_vha, 0xb072,
-                   "Failed to acquire IDC lock. retrying...\n");
-               /* Retry/Perform IDC-Lock recovery */
-               if (qla83xx_idc_lock_recovery(base_vha) == QLA_SUCCESS) {
-                       qla83xx_wait_logic();
-                       goto retry_lock2;
-               } else
-                       ql_log(ql_log_warn, base_vha, 0xb076,
-                           "IDC Lock recovery FAILED.\n");
-       }
-
-       return;
 }
 
 void
-- 
2.22.0.770.g0f2c4a37fd-goog

Reply via email to